Essential Job Functions:

• Must be mature, enthusiastic, imaginative, energetic, creative, have strong leadership skills and ability to work independently with minimal supervision. • Ability to work effectively in a TEAM environment. • Strong communication, problem-solving, organization, and mediation skills. • Ability to motivate and maintain a positive atmosphere, and if necessary, use positive disciplinary techniques. • Working knowledge of company safety protocols and ability to administer minor medical care. • Leadership, alertness, and patience. • Ability to work in a fast-paced environment, adapt to last minute changes. • Physical stamina and ability to sit or stand for extended periods of time. • Ability to withstand working outdoors in extreme weather conditions. • Must be able to lift, pull, push or drag up to 60 pounds of equipment, i.e. ice chest, supply boxes, inventory. • Commit to the seasonal schedule. • Must be able to attend camp counselor orientation and training prior to the first day of camp. • Provides high-quality programming and recreational opportunities and enjoyable experiences for camp participants ages 6-15. • Supervises campers and ensures their safety, development, growth, skill achievement, and general well-being. • Organizes and leads various small and large group activities. • Ensures cleanliness of the site, sweeping, mopping, throwing away trash, cleaning up after activities. • Assists in maintaining accurate program records, including incident reports and daily attendance. • Mediates any campers' disputes. • Knows, enforces, and follows all safety guidelines associated with the camp program, always including the whereabouts of your campers. • Providing positive and enthusiastic customer service to all Members and guests. • Maintains constant surveillance of the pool area and be confident in the water. • Ability to use sound judgement in handling disciple issue with campers, and to make quick decisions to ensure safety of all. • Accompany groups on field trips.

Benefits: For city employees who are regular part time (10-19 hours per week) or seasonal hired placed on City payroll, the following benefits are provided: • PARS - Public Agency Retirement System: the employee contributes 6.2% each paycheck to this retirement system and the city provides 1.3%. • The employee does not pay into Social Security. • All of the employees contributions may be withdrawn upon separating service from the city. • The Citys contributions will not be paid unless the employee retires under the system. • Part time or seasonal employees are not eligible for any paid leave or other benefits. • Part time or seasonal employees are limited to working only 1,000 hours per 12-month period, unless the seasonal is project based for a specific period of time which is typically less than 12-months.
